Direct Labor Costs
Costs that can be directly attributed to the production of goods or services, including wages of workers physically making a product.
Hours Worked
The total number of hours that an employee has been present and active in carrying out their job duties within a specific period.
Job Order Costing System
An accounting method that tracks manufacturing costs individually for each job, suitable for customized orders or projects.
Actual Overhead Costs
The real costs incurred from overhead activities, as opposed to budgeted or estimated overhead costs, including utilities, rent, and insurance.
